Fine Art Friday: Colin Chillag




Colin Chillag makes work that seems unfinished but seems dedicated to taking the mystery of the process out of the task of painting. He leaves sketched lines, paint globs, color patterns and other steps of the rendering process embedded in the work to help comunicate some of the "behind the scenes" elements of art. Personally, I like that you can see the start to finish bits and pieces and how it feels like you interrupted the work somehow and can imagine it still being worked on. Maybe it is just me, but check it out and see how to make the "making of" as much of the art as the art itself.
